ACADEMIC BEHAVIOR&COMMUNITY ACAD
Academic Behavior&Community Acad is a public high school that is part of the Adam/Brwn/Cass/Morgn/Pik/Sctt ROE school district, located in Quincy, IL with about 24 students offering grade levels from 10th Grade to 12th Grade. With about 3 teachers, Academic Behavior&Community Acad has a student/teacher ratio of about 8: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. A lower student/teacher ratio is a key factor that determines how much a teacher can devote his/her time to each individual student thus improving, or reducing (in the event of a higher student/teacher ratio) the attention each student is given for their educational needs.
The **Academic Behavior & Community Academy (ABC Academy)**, located at 1416 Maine St in Quincy, Illinois, is a specialized educational program designed to serve students who require more intensive behavioral and social-emotional support than what is typically provided in a traditional classroom setting. Operating under the umbrella of the Quincy Public Schools district, the academy focuses on creating a structured, therapeutic environment where students can address behavioral challenges while continuing their academic progress.
The core mission of the school is to help students develop the coping strategies, self-regulation skills, and social competencies necessary to succeed both in school and the community. By maintaining smaller class sizes and utilizing a multidisciplinary approach—which often involves close collaboration between teachers, counselors, and support staff—the academy provides a personalized educational experience. The ultimate goal of the ABC Academy is to equip students with the tools they need to transition back to their home schools or successfully complete their graduation requirements in a supportive and focused atmosphere.

* A public charter school is a publicly funded school that is typically governed by a group or organization under a legislative contract with the state, the district, or another entity. The charter exempts the school from certain state or local rules and regulations.
1 The National School Lunch Program (NSLP) provides eligible students with free or reduced-price lunch
2 Title I, Part A (Title I) of the Elementary and Secondary Education Act prov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families.
